Abstract EN
The toxic effect of three insecticides: dimethoate (organophosphate insecticide), acetamiprid (neonicotinoid insecticide) and deltamethrin (pyrethroid insecticide) were evaluated in vitro on cultured Sf9 cell line.
Cell growth inhibition was measured by the 3-(4,5-dimethylthiazol-2-yl)-2,5-diphenyl tetrazolium bromide (MTT) assay.
Regression Analysis was used to estimate the 20% inhibition of cells growth (IC20).
The IC20 values obtained for deltamethrin, acetamiprid and dimethoate were: 46.8, 61.6 and 68.9 μM, respectively.
The proportion of phagocytic cells was positively correlated with the applied concentrations of the insecticides.
